Looking for Divorce Lawyers in Hebbronville?

Divorce lawyers specialize in the legal dissolution of a marriage. They guide clients through the complexities of dividing assets and debts, determining spousal support (alimony), and resolving disputes through negotiation, mediation, or litigation when necessary. These attorneys advocate for their clients’ financial interests to achieve a fair and equitable settlement or court order.

After I am married, am I entitled to part of the interest on his money market account or can he keep it all and reinvest?

Generally income which accrues during the marriage is joint. On the other hand, if he has investment accounts which are in his own name and which accrued previous to the marriage, those accumulations would generally be separate property as well. You really need to have an attorney looked into the situation to determine your rights. As an aside, as you are not yet married yet concerned about this, I would suggest that you might rethink entering into the relationship. Such concerns do not bode well for a planned life union.

My Lawyer wife makes as much as I, is getting fully paid off house, do I still pay Texas calculator based child support?

Because your wife is an attorney, it is strongly recommended that you hire an attorney to protect your financial interests and access to your children. It sounds as though you two are still in negotiations about your divorce settlement, but it is unclear if you two have gone to mediation on these issues. Mediation is a metting where husbands and wives discuss their concerns and privately decide what assets they intend to divide and what arrangements they want to make for child support and visitation in a divorce. If you are unrepresented, you are at a grave disadvantage because your lawyer wife likely has an attorney and her own legal knowledge to tip the scales of fairness against you.  If you'd like to share custody of your children in lieu of child support, that is an option to discuss with your wife and her attorney, but I do not know if this is appropriate. That decisions depends on the age of your children and the distance the two of you live from one another.
